Other New Testament Letters

Philippians  Unity through humility, joy, and reconciliation  Jesus showed humility by becoming human (Kenosis)  Used the metaphor of a footrace to talk about the need for perseverance

Colossians  Warned the church to stay away from Roman and Greek cults and mystery religions  Told to not mix pagan worship with the church

First and Second Thessalonians First Thessalonians  Paul described what the return of Christ would be like Second Thessalonians  Thessalonians had to keep going about everyday life until the return of Christ

Personal Letters of Paul First, Second Timothy and Titus  Warnings against false teaching  Church Government Philemon Philemon  Mercy request for an escape slave named Onesimus

Letters by Others Hebrews  Law of Moses was no longer in effect  Definition of faith (Hebrews 11:1)  Bible’s Hall of Fame (Hebrews Ch. 11) James  Handbook to life  Main theme “faith plus works”

Letters by Others First and Second Peter  Hope for suffering Christians  Description of the End Times First, Second, and Third John  God is love  “Antichrist”- someone who denies the divinity of Jesus Jude  Opposition to false teaching (Apostasy)
